## Authentication

SproutMinder's scheduler API requires key-based authentication for every request, including status checks. Support staff troubleshooting watering schedules should always confirm the key is current before escalating, since expired keys return a generic 403 rather than a descriptive error. For sandbox reproduction of customer issues, use the shared internal key below.

gateway credential: kto3_qfe

**Mgmt Meeting Minutes — Retiring the Brightline Range**

Quick recap for sales leads at Fenholt Supplies: we agreed to retire the Brightline fixture range by year-end. Remaining stock moves to clearance pricing next month, and accounts on standing orders get migrated to the Lumetta range. Trade-in incentives were approved in principle. The confidential note on next steps sits just below.

board note of bajof-bajeg: The pricing group signed off on a budget of $13.4 million for Project Sildor. The renewal with Lamixek Holdings closes at $48.9 million a year, 49 percent above the last contract.

Release checklist — Orbit Kiosk watchdog (for security sign-off). Quick one, but don't skip it: the watchdog is what yanks the kiosk back to the lock screen if the shell crashes or someone tries to pin the UI mid-update. Verify the watchdog binary is signed, runs as its own unprivileged account, and can't be killed from the kiosk session itself. Also confirm the restart loop caps at five attempts before going to safe mode. Once you've verified all that, note the release build token below.

pipeline stamp: htk31_f769b577b3028a4e9958e5bb8d1259a

Visitors arriving via the Larkspur Campus shuttle must enter through Gate C only, which reception staff open remotely between 07:30 and 19:00. Please verify each visitor against the day sheet before releasing the gate, and ensure the shuttle driver confirms the passenger count. If the remote release fails, a staff member must walk down and use the keypad, entering the gate code shown below.

door code, kawip-bagap: bdg-HQEWH-4